Why I’m on Couchsurfing

COUCHSURFING EXPERIENCE

So far I haven't surfed that much, but up until recently I was living in a large sharehouse/squat with, in addition to the 7 housemates, an extra 2 to 6 peeps per night!! I learnt a lot in that time, about other places in the world, how to be considerate of others, how to manage conflict, but also how cool it is to have 15 or more people all cooking and eating together all the time, how people's individual interests can benefit a whole house, and how much fun you can have without leaving a house sometime.
